The Shangrila activity mat and arch pictured above is awesome! One side has black and white graphics great for newborns for neuro-optic stimulation, while the other side is a plush colorful mat great for just relaxing or playing with the stuffed creatures that hang from the arch. There are all sorts of great toys that attach to the mat, like a peek-a-boo activity toy, hide and seek toy, mirror, and many more. The arch is removable and the mat folds up nicely into the carry bag, nice for traveling. This playmat is completely different from all others, its great. The Boa, stack and squeeze toy is one of my daughters favorites. Each ring has a different sound, pig, cow, frog, and bird. The rings are soft and colorful, with several different textures, your baby will love it. The head of the boa when pressed makes a giggling sound sure to make your baby laugh. The Boa is great for tactile stimulation, auditory and visual development, dexterity, and flexible play.

The Stacrobats are my favorite. With these great magnetic toys, your baby can create their own circus. It comes with five magnetic people, three magnetic balls, and a colorful carrying case that doubles as a platform for the Stacrobats. The Stacrobats improve dexterity, encourage independent and explorative play, creativity and self-confidence. I love them.

And for the teething baby, Linko. Bright colors, a variety of textures, and lots of fun. It comes with three plush toys, four teethers, and four rings. The Linko can also be attached to other Kushies toys with their clip. The Linko promotes dexterity, tactile stimulation, and eye-mouth coordination.
